Maryland trip gets high marks

Orlando Bishop Moore three-star running back A.J. Brooks has been a recruit flying low under the radar screen, but he did take his second official visit to Maryland this weekend.
“We went with him and had a great time,” Brooks’ father, Christopher Sims, said. “It was a wonderful school, and he liked everything that he saw. He was impressed with the coaches, players and everything he saw. We think it would be a good place for him.”

But it’s not the only option.
Brooks has already visited Duke and is set to visit Boston College on January 16. UCF has also offered him a scholarship.
Brooks, who is 6-foot and 192 pounds, is ranked as the nation’s No. 51 running back.
